From 4dfb331560ca490d90eb8533daa79efd7450ec36 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?=D0=90=D0=BB=D0=B5=D0=BA=D1=81=D0=B0=D0=BD=D0=B4=D1=80=20?= =?UTF-8?q?=D0=93=D0=B0=D0=BB=D0=BA=D0=B8=D0=BD?= Date: Mon, 16 Feb 2026 16:47:28 +0300 Subject: [PATCH] fix(security): harden shell denylist, block metachar escapes, deny-by-default ACL M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it Close critical attack chain: empty allow_from → any user → prompt injection → exec denylist bypass → full system access. - Expand shell denylist with 10 new patterns (rm long flags, base64→shell, python/perl/ruby -c/-e, eval, curl/wget→shell, find -exec rm, xargs rm, fdisk/parted/wipefs) - Block shell metacharacters ($(), ${}, backticks), $VAR expansion and cd /absolute in workspace-restricted mode - Change empty allow_from from allow-all to deny-all (deny-by-default) - Add logger.WarnCF at all block points and rejected messages - Add tests for 18 bypass techniques, 6 metacharacter escapes, and 5 safe-command allowance checks Co-Authored-By: Claude Opus 4.6 --- pkg/channels/base.go | 13 ++++- pkg/channels/base_test.go | 4 +- pkg/channels/slack_test.go | 6 +- pkg/tools/shell.go | 85 ++++++++++++++++++++++++++++- pkg/tools/shell_test.go | 109 ++++++++++++++++++++++++++++++++++++- 5 files changed, 207 insertions(+), 10 deletions(-) diff --git a/pkg/channels/base.go b/pkg/channels/base.go index 8d2d9a65b..fc9a66013 100644 --- a/pkg/channels/base.go +++ b/pkg/channels/base.go @@ -6,6 +6,7 @@ import ( "strings" "github.com/sipeed/picoclaw/pkg/bus" + "github.com/sipeed/picoclaw/pkg/logger" ) type Channel interface { @@ -26,6 +27,11 @@ type BaseChannel struct { } func NewBaseChannel(name string, config interface{}, bus *bus.MessageBus, allowList []string) *BaseChannel { + if len(allowList) == 0 { + logger.WarnCF("channel", "Channel has empty allow_from: all messages will be rejected until configured", map[string]interface{}{ + "channel": name, + }) + } return &BaseChannel{ config: config, bus: bus, @@ -45,7 +51,7 @@ func (c *BaseChannel) IsRunning() bool { func (c *BaseChannel) IsAllowed(senderID string) bool { if len(c.allowList) == 0 { -
